Pro initiatives is currently supporting a fantastic Military Veterans Charity to deliver its mission to provide life-changing employment opportunities to ex-military personnel that truly transforms lives. Face-to-face fundraising can be a fantastic and truly rewarding career if you’re outgoing and a great communicator.
You don’t need to have fundraising experience as we provide training when you join the team, including learning all about the amazing charity you’ll be supporting. We just need you to bring your awesome personality and boundless enthusiasm to the role.
- You’ll be asking the public for cash or contactless one-off donations in private sites.
- Venue permitting, you’ll also aim to recruit supporters to give the charity a monthly donation.
- Venues will be sourced for you to include supermarkets, shopping centres, etc.
- Your induction will include how to be compliant and excellent at face-to-face fundraising.
- You’ll learn about the charity you’ll be supporting, to speak with knowledge and passion.
- You’ll spend time in the field with your manager so you can feel confident and supported.
- You’ll be supplied with all the fundraising materials you will need to excel.
You must be outgoing and great at starting conversations. You must be honest, hard-working, and able to work autonomously as well as within a team. You must have a right to work in the UK. You must have a full driver’s licence and a car.

✨Tip Number 1
Get to know the charity you'll be supporting inside out! The more you understand their mission and impact, the better you'll connect with potential donors. We recommend doing a bit of research and even chatting with current fundraisers to get the lowdown.
✨Tip Number 2
Practice your pitch! You want to sound natural and enthusiastic when you're talking to people. Grab a friend or family member and run through what you’ll say. This will help you feel more confident when you’re out there fundraising.
✨Tip Number 3
Be ready to adapt! Not everyone will respond the same way, so be prepared to switch up your approach based on the vibe you’re getting. We all have our unique styles, so find what works best for you while staying true to the charity's message.
✨Tip Number 4
Don’t forget to follow up! If someone shows interest but doesn’t donate on the spot, make a note to check back with them later. Building relationships is key in fundraising, and we’re here to support you every step of the way!
